Heartland Security Insurance Group is a diversified insurance holding company comprised of seven individual companies.
Each company offers risk management solutions to distinct client groups.
HHC-Hibbs-Hallmark & Co.
, Inc.
a subsidiary of Heartland Security Insurance Group is a retail independent insurance agency providing insurance and risk management products and services nationwide.
Insurance Service Representative Starting Pay:
$33,000 Primary Responsibility The Commercial Lines Account Processor will be primarily responsible for servicing and handling of commercial accounts.
Essential Functions & Responsibilities Provide technical support for the account executive and account manager in processing all lines of commercial insurance in accordance with the objectives and procedures outlined in the agency procedures.
Assist with marketing process, prepare proposals/summaries and premium comparisons Complete all billings and invoicing on new business, renewals, endorsement, audits and monthly reports Policy checking Pursue Property & Casualty License Responsible for maintaining the integrity of client and policy information in the agency management system.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
